The place
Where Dār Kā’id al ‘Atīq sits
Dār Kā’id al ‘Atīq is the 300th-largest listed city in Dhi Qar and the 4235th-largest in Iraq.
It sits 320 km southeast of Baghdad.
Local clocks run on Baghdad time (Asia/Baghdad).
The nearest big city is Nasiriyah, 24 km to the west.

When a Dār Kā’id al ‘Atīq exit is worth asking for
What a Dār Kā’id al ‘Atīq exit buys you over any other Iraq address is locality, not identity. A site that only reads the country treats Dār Kā’id al ‘Atīq and Baghdad identically, and the great majority of geo-checks work exactly that way.
The difference shows up on local questions: search results with a map pack, stock in nearby stores, delivery windows, prices that vary by area. For those, request Dār Kā’id al ‘Atīq. For everything else a plain Iraq exit does the same job with none of the supply constraints.
